From 449653b2213259d2f93a2ae91e1acee1cf5d9e4d Mon Sep 17 00:00:00 2001 From: idk Date: Sat, 6 Mar 2021 19:57:47 +0000 Subject: [PATCH] improve the activitystream defaults --- src/app-profile/prefs.js | 9 ++++++++- src/app-profile/user.js | 13 +++++++------ src/nsis/i2pbrowser-installer.nsi | 2 +- src/profile/prefs.js | 10 ++++++++-- src/profile/user.js | 9 +++++++-- 5 files changed, 31 insertions(+), 12 deletions(-) diff --git a/src/app-profile/prefs.js b/src/app-profile/prefs.js index 4b932b4..193712b 100644 --- a/src/app-profile/prefs.js +++ b/src/app-profile/prefs.js @@ -45,4 +45,11 @@ user_pref("extensions.allowPrivateBrowsingByDefault", true); user_pref("extensions.PrivateBrowsing.notification", false); user_pref("toolkit.legacyUserProfileCustomizations.stylesheets", true); - +user_pref("extensions.pocket.enabled", false); +user_pref("browser.newtabpage.activity-stream.showSponsoredTopSites", false); +user_pref("browser.newtabpage.activity-stream.showSponsored", false); +user_pref("services.sync.prefs.sync.browser.newtabpage.activity-stream.showSponsored", false); +user_pref("browser.newtabpage.activity-stream.feeds.section.highlights", false); +user_pref("browser.newtabpage.activity-stream.feeds.section.topstories", false); +user_pref("browser.newtabpage.activity-stream.default.sites", "http://127.0.0.1:7657/home,http://127.0.0.1:7657/i2psnark/,http://127.0.0.1:7657/susimail/"); +user_pref("browser.newtabpage.activity-stream.feeds.topsites", true); diff --git a/src/app-profile/user.js b/src/app-profile/user.js index 83332c9..985a1de 100644 --- a/src/app-profile/user.js +++ b/src/app-profile/user.js @@ -205,13 +205,14 @@ user_pref("toolkit.telemetry.unified", false); user_pref("webgl.disabled", true); user_pref("browser.chrome.errorReporter.infoURL", ""); user_pref("breakpad.reportURL", ""); -user_pref("browser.newtabpage.activity-stream.default.sites", ""); -//user_pref("browser.newtabpage.activity-stream.default.sites", "http://planet.i2p/,http://legwork.i2p/,http://i2pwiki.i2p/,http://i2pforums.i2p/,http://zzz.i2p/"); +//user_pref("browser.newtabpage.activity-stream.default.sites", ""); +user_pref("browser.newtabpage.activity-stream.showSponsoredTopSites", false); +user_pref("browser.newtabpage.activity-stream.showSponsored", false); +user_pref("services.sync.prefs.sync.browser.newtabpage.activity-stream.showSponsored", false); +user_pref("browser.newtabpage.enabled", true); +user_pref("browser.newtabpage.activity-stream.default.sites", "http://127.0.0.1:7657/home,http://127.0.0.1:7657/i2psnark/,http://127.0.0.1:7657/susimail/"); user_pref("dom.security.https_only_mode", false); user_pref("keyword.enabled", false); user_pref("extensions.allowPrivateBrowsingByDefault", true); user_pref("extensions.PrivateBrowsing.notification", false); -// PREF: re-enable crome/userChrome.css -user_pref("toolkit.legacyUserProfileCustomizations.stylesheets", true); - -// pref("toolkit.legacyUserProfileCustomizations.stylesheets", true); +user_pref("browser.newtabpage.activity-stream.feeds.topsites", true); diff --git a/src/nsis/i2pbrowser-installer.nsi b/src/nsis/i2pbrowser-installer.nsi index 95e663f..c1ff60b 100644 --- a/src/nsis/i2pbrowser-installer.nsi +++ b/src/nsis/i2pbrowser-installer.nsi @@ -277,7 +277,7 @@ Section Install # Install the config userChrome createDirectory "$LOCALAPPDATA\${APPNAME}\firefox.profile.config.i2p\chrome" SetOutPath "$LOCALAPPDATA\${APPNAME}\firefox.profile.config.i2p\chrome" - File profile/chrome/userChrome.css + File app-profile/chrome/userChrome.css SetOutPath "$INSTDIR" createDirectory "$SMPROGRAMS\${APPNAME}" diff --git a/src/profile/prefs.js b/src/profile/prefs.js index 62c8239..73feac8 100644 --- a/src/profile/prefs.js +++ b/src/profile/prefs.js @@ -43,5 +43,11 @@ user_pref("dom.security.https_only_mode", false); user_pref("keyword.enabled", false); user_pref("extensions.allowPrivateBrowsingByDefault", true); user_pref("extensions.PrivateBrowsing.notification", false); - - +user_pref("extensions.pocket.enabled", false); +user_pref("browser.newtabpage.activity-stream.showSponsoredTopSites", false); +user_pref("browser.newtabpage.activity-stream.showSponsored", false); +user_pref("services.sync.prefs.sync.browser.newtabpage.activity-stream.showSponsored", false); +user_pref("browser.newtabpage.activity-stream.feeds.section.highlights", false); +user_pref("browser.newtabpage.activity-stream.feeds.section.topstories", false); +user_pref("browser.newtabpage.activity-stream.default.sites", "http://planet.i2p/,http://legwork.i2p/,http://i2pwiki.i2p/,http://i2pforums.i2p/,http://zzz.i2p/"); +user_pref("browser.newtabpage.activity-stream.feeds.topsites", true); diff --git a/src/profile/user.js b/src/profile/user.js index 226385d..99385e9 100644 --- a/src/profile/user.js +++ b/src/profile/user.js @@ -205,9 +205,14 @@ user_pref("toolkit.telemetry.unified", false); user_pref("webgl.disabled", true); user_pref("browser.chrome.errorReporter.infoURL", ""); user_pref("breakpad.reportURL", ""); -user_pref("browser.newtabpage.activity-stream.default.sites", ""); -//user_pref("browser.newtabpage.activity-stream.default.sites", "http://planet.i2p/,http://legwork.i2p/,http://i2pwiki.i2p/,http://i2pforums.i2p/,http://zzz.i2p/"); +//user_pref("browser.newtabpage.activity-stream.default.sites", ""); +user_pref("browser.newtabpage.activity-stream.showSponsoredTopSites", false); +user_pref("browser.newtabpage.activity-stream.showSponsored", false); +user_pref("services.sync.prefs.sync.browser.newtabpage.activity-stream.showSponsored", false); +user_pref("browser.newtabpage.enabled", true); +user_pref("browser.newtabpage.activity-stream.default.sites", "http://planet.i2p/,http://legwork.i2p/,http://i2pwiki.i2p/,http://i2pforums.i2p/,http://zzz.i2p/"); user_pref("dom.security.https_only_mode", false); user_pref("keyword.enabled", false); user_pref("extensions.allowPrivateBrowsingByDefault", true); user_pref("extensions.PrivateBrowsing.notification", false); +user_pref("browser.newtabpage.activity-stream.feeds.topsites", true);